ISFJ
The Protector
ISFJs are warm-hearted and responsible individuals who are dedicated to helping others and maintaining harmony.
Cognitive Functions
Si (Introverted Sensing)
Primary function that focuses on past experiences and details. ISFJs use experience to guide decisions.
Fe (Extraverted Feeling)
Auxiliary function that considers others' emotions and needs. Helps ISFJs maintain harmony and support others.
Ti (Introverted Thinking)
Tertiary function that analyzes information logically. Develops more with age and experience.
Ne (Extraverted Intuition)
Inferior function that explores possibilities. Often a source of stress but can be developed.
Strengths
- Loyal and dedicated to others
- Strong sense of duty and responsibility
- Excellent memory for details
- Supportive and nurturing nature
- Practical and organized approach
Challenges
- May neglect their own needs
- Can be overly sensitive to criticism
- Difficulty saying no to requests
- May resist change and new ideas
- Can become overwhelmed by stress
